Output 68aaaf4acdfeeb9425a265c9200f52c90be55159a798273906ee324083d49a3c:1

value
4408519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21cc768a65acdf8d8e73236f5618a190d3baa826 OP_EQUAL
address
34mjADUTUMD7zYeWdR3891tpdfEmsA52Xy
transaction
68aaaf4acdfeeb9425a265c9200f52c90be55159a798273906ee324083d49a3c